Analyzing the Problem of Your Siding
Just how can homeowners accurately identify the state of their siding? To evaluate the problem of siding, home owners need to start with an extensive aesthetic assessment. This includes checking for noticeable signs of damage, such as splits, warping, or staining. They ought to additionally seek loosened panels or sections that might have come removed. In addition, homeowners ought to check out the caulking and seals around home windows and doors, as degeneration in these locations can indicate underlying issues. It is useful to evaluate the siding throughout different climate condition, as moisture or sunlight can expose concerns not noticeable in dry, cloudy weather. If possible, home owners can conduct a moisture meter test to identify trapped moisture that might bring about mold and mildew or rot. Ultimately, looking for expert advice can give a specialist examination, making sure that any kind of potential concerns are attended to without delay. This aggressive method aids preserve the integrity and look of the home.
Usual Sorts Of Siding Damages
Siding damage can materialize in numerous types, each needing details interest to preserve the home's exterior. Typical kinds include warping, which usually occurs due to long term exposure to dampness or extreme temperatures, endangering the siding's architectural honesty. Splits and divides can develop from temperature level changes or physical effects, bring about extra damage if left unaddressed. Insect infestations, specifically from termites, can trigger substantial damages, necessitating immediate intervention to secure the home. Furthermore, fading and staining from UV direct exposure takes away from visual allure and might suggest the demand for painting or substitute. Mold and mildew and mold development can additionally create in wet locations, posturing health and wellness risks and damaging the siding product. siding repair greenville nc. Lastly, loose or absent panels can result from harsh climate problems, requiring timely fixings to ensure the home remains protected and aesthetically enticing. Dealing with these issues without delay is important for maintaining the home's worth and aesthetic appeals
Devices and Materials Needed for Repair
An effective siding repair task hinges on having the right devices and materials at hand. Important devices include a gauging tape for precise measurements, an energy knife for reducing siding, and a pry bar for removing broken areas. A degree assurances appropriate positioning during installation, while a hammer and nails or a nail gun promote safe fastening.
In regards to products, home owners should collect replacement siding that matches the existing product, whether it be vinyl, timber, or fiber concrete. Caulk and paint are needed for sealing voids and completing touches, guaranteeing a seamless appearance. Furthermore, safety gear such as handwear covers and safety glasses is important to shield versus debris and sharp edges.
Having these tools and materials prepared not just simplifies the repair process but additionally adds to an expert coating that enhances the home's aesthetic appeal. Correct preparation establishes the stage for a successful and efficient siding repair endeavor.

Age of Siding
The age of siding plays a substantial duty in determining whether replacement is needed. Normally, siding products have More hints differing life expectancies; as an example, timber siding may last around 20 to 40 years, while vinyl can sustain for 30 to half a century. As siding ages, it might shed its protective top qualities, bring about concerns such as bending, fading, or fracturing. Home owners ought to likewise consider the frequency of repair and maintenance; if repair work are coming to be a lot more regular, it may indicate the need for an upgrade. In addition, obsolete siding can diminish a home's curb allure, making substitute an appealing choice. Reviewing both the age and condition of the siding is vital for making an informed choice about replacement.
Selecting the Right Siding Material for Your Home
Choosing the ideal siding product can substantially boost a home's visual and architectural honesty. Property owners should take into consideration different factors, consisting of climate, budget, and desired look. Vinyl siding uses cost and low upkeep, making it a popular selection. Timber siding gives a classic, all-natural look however requires extra upkeep. Fiber cement siding combines toughness with adaptability, mimicking the appearance of timber while resisting pests and rot.
In addition, rock or block veneers can include a touch of sophistication and longevity. It's critical to assess insulation residential or commercial properties and power performance, as these can significantly impact home Click Here heating and air conditioning expenses. Property owners need to also take into consideration neighborhood building regulations and neighborhood aesthetic appeals to assure their selection matches bordering residential properties. Eventually, the best siding material will integrate with the home's style while supplying protection and value. Cautious consideration of these elements will certainly result in a successful siding choice that enhances aesthetic charm.
Keeping Your Siding for Long-Term Curb Allure
Exactly how can property owners ensure their siding keeps its allure throughout the years? Normal maintenance is important for maintaining siding's aesthetic and useful top qualities. Home owners must arrange yearly evaluations to recognize concerns such as cracks, peeling off paint, or mold growth. Immediately resolving these troubles prevents additional damage and boosts visual allure.
Cleaning the siding at the very least twice a year is likewise important. Making use of mild pressure washing or a soft brush with mild cleaning agent helps get rid of dirt and mold. Furthermore, homeowners ought to keep gutters clear to prevent water damage, which can adversely impact siding stability.
Applying protective finishings or sealants can extend the life of materials like wood or vinyl. Furthermore, ensuring appropriate air flow in attics and creep rooms lessens wetness build-up, which can weaken siding in time. By following these techniques, property owners can guarantee their siding remains eye-catching and functional for several years ahead, ultimately improving their home's aesthetic allure.
